Understanding the Role of AC Hoses

AC hoses are vital in maintaining the efficacy of the vehicle's cooling system.
The specific hose connecting the compressor to the condenser must withstand high pressures and temperatures since this is where refrigerant is compressed before cooling. Hence, choosing a hose designed for resilience and efficient performance is non-negotiable for system longevity.
Key Material Considerations
Hoses are typically made from materials such as rubber, thermoplastic, or a composite of several layers. While rubber hoses are traditional and affordable, they tend to wear out faster compared to their modern counterparts. Thermoplastic hoses, on the other hand, offer better resistance to aging and temperature variations, making them suitable for modern high-performance AC systems. Multi-layered composite hoses combine the benefits of both materials, providing flexibility and durability without compromising structural integrity.
Performance Ratings and Specifications
Not all hoses are created equal. A vital consideration is the hose's pressure rating and its ability to handle the specific refrigerant used in your AC system. Compatibility with R-134a and R-1234yf, the most common refrigerants today, is essential. Ensure that the hose meets SAE standards such as J2064, which specifies performance requirements for automotive refrigerant air-conditioning hoses and assemblies.
Expert Installation Tips

Even the highest-quality hose will underperform if not installed correctly. Proper installation includes checking the fittings for any signs of corrosion or damage, ensuring a snug fit without over-tightening, and using compatible fittings to prevent leaks. Furthermore, inspect existing connectors for wear and replace them with high-quality options if necessary.
Long-term Maintenance and Inspection
Routine inspections are essential to catch potential issues before they escalate. Look for signs of wear, such as cracks or softness, which can indicate that the hose is deteriorating. Periodic pressure testing can also help detect slow leaks that may not be immediately visible.
